About the position

The Administrative Aide position is a vital role within Tulare County, specifically within the Health & Human Services Agency located in Visalia, CA. This recruitment aims to establish an employment list to fill current and future vacancies for this position. The anticipated life of the employment list is six months, and interested candidates are encouraged to submit an online application for consideration. The role involves a variety of administrative tasks that support the operations of the agency, including data collection, analysis, and the preparation of reports. The successful candidate will be responsible for conducting research, analyzing information, and formulating recommendations in various report formats. Additionally, the position requires the development and implementation of record-keeping systems, maintenance of data files, and preparation of memos, letters, and statistical reports. In this role, the Administrative Aide will assist in processing administrative reports, prepare meeting agendas, and take minutes. The position also involves interpreting and applying legislation, rules, and regulations relevant to agency and departmental practices. The aide will work closely with personnel services officers on benefit and compensation matters and assist in the coordination of the new hire process. The role may also include indirect supervision of staff, volunteers, and inmate workers, as well as placing purchase orders with vendors and giving presentations before staff and groups. The Administrative Aide will serve on various committees and assist in preparing and monitoring budgets, ensuring compliance with programs and contracts. Candidates for this position should possess a strong educational background, with a minimum of two years of college coursework in public or business administration or a closely related field. Additionally, candidates should have at least one year of experience providing responsible administrative support. The role requires knowledge of basic math, personal computers, and various software applications, as well as the ability to communicate effectively with individuals from diverse backgrounds. The position demands strong organizational skills, the ability to multitask in a fast-paced environment, and proficiency in word processing, spreadsheet, and database programs. A valid California driver's license is also required.
